Enhancing Solar Street Light Performance and Efficiency
To ensure the optimal performance and efficiency of solar street lights, several key factors must be evaluated. A well-designed placement that maximizes sunlight exposure is crucial. This involves choosing solar street light a position with minimal shading from trees, buildings, or other obstacles. Additionally, selecting high-quality solar panels with a superior conversion rate will improve overall energy generation. Regular inspection of the panels and batteries is also essential to eliminate dirt or debris that can reduce their performance. Moreover, utilizing smart lighting controls can greatly optimize energy usage by varying light output based on ambient light conditions and time of day.
